Haliade 150-6MW
The Haliade™ 150-6MW is a threebladed wind turbine with a 150 m diameter rotor and a rated power of 6 MW. The turbine has been designed following Class I-B specications of the standards IEC-61400-1 / IEC-61400-3.

How does a 6 MW wind turbine work?
The Pure Torque design of the 6 MW wind turbine protects the generator to ensure and improve its performance by diverting unwanted stresses from the wind safely to the turbine’s tower though the main frame. This allows the minimum air gap to be maintained between the generator rotor and stator all times, offering the highest efficiency.

What is a turbina sapiens wind turbine?
Turbina Sapiens A different breed of wind turbine The Siemens 6.0 MW offshore wind turbine redefines the wind industry standards for leanness, robustness and lifecycle profitability. Based on Siemens Direct Drive technology, the 6.0 MW turbine has 50% fewer moving parts than comparable geared machines and a towerhead mass of less than 350 tons.
